A Dendroecological Fire History for Central Corsica/France

Tree-Ring Research, 2020
Forest fires are an important factor shaping Mediterranean ecosystems and determine the distribution of different species. Information about past forest fires can be obtained with pyrodendroecology. Here, we present a fire history for three sites in the mountain forest belt on the island of Corsica in the Mediterranean Basin.

Dendroecological Applications to Coarse Woody Debris Dynamics

2017
Coarse woody debris plays a crucial role in forest ecosystems. The current amount of woody debris on a given site represents a balance between additions (tree mortality) and depletions (wood decomposition, combustion, transport). Dendroecological analyses for olive cultivar characterization

2023
Due to global warming, a significant increase in frequency and severity of drought episodes is predicted in the Mediterranean Region. Olive (Olea europaea L.) is a relatively drought-tolerant tree species cultivated in Mediterranean region. However, prolonged hot and dry summer can induce hydraulic stress, leading to fruit yield reduction.
